Can I have a smart gate if I also have a pool?

Yes, but integration is key. Any gate providing access to a pool must have a self-closing, self-latching mechanism per IBC/IRC pool barrier codes. A smart gate's IoT latch system must be engineered to default to a latched position upon closure to meet this standard. This dual-function design is now a common liability requirement for Missouri homeowners.

What are the critical steps before digging fence post holes?

First, contact Missouri 811 to mark all underground utilities. Hitting a gas or fiber line in the Downtown neighborhood carries major repair costs and liability. Second, secure a permit from the Louisiana permit office. The 811 locate ticket and site plan are typically required for permit approval. Do not excavate without both steps complete.

What fencing material is best for Louisiana's environment?

Material compatibility is critical. The area has a Moderate Soil Corrosivity Index and a Moderate to Heavy Termite Risk. Galvanized steel posts and hardware are recommended for corrosion resistance. Use pressure-treated wood rated for ground contact and stainless steel fasteners to prevent rust streaks. Avoid untreated wood in direct soil contact.

Is my fence designed to handle high winds?

Engineering for a 115 MPH V-ult wind speed dictates the structure. This rating requires specific post spacing, concrete footing mass, and bracket strength per ASCE 7-22 standards. A standard 6-foot privacy fence will fail in a peak storm season gust if not designed for this load. Properly engineered connections at the post-to-rail joint are non-negotiable.

What are the height and setback rules for my property?

Louisiana zoning code limits fence height to 4 feet in front yards and 6 feet in rear yards. A 0-foot setback is allowed, meaning you can build directly on the property line. For corner lots, a clear 'sight triangle' is required at intersections to maintain driver visibility, a critical safety measure for properties near US Highway 54.

Am I legally required to notify my neighbor before building a fence?

Yes. Under Missouri Revised Statutes Section 272.030, you must provide written notice to the adjoining landowner before altering or replacing a shared partition fence. In 2026, this 'good neighbor law' is strictly enforced in Louisiana. Failure to provide notice can result in shared cost disputes and legal liability for the new structure.

How deep should my fence posts be set to prevent frost heave?

All fence posts in Louisiana, MO, require a footing extending a minimum of 30 inches below grade to be set below the local frost line. The IRC mandates this to prevent frost heave, which lifts and cracks posts. In the Downtown Louisiana neighborhood, soil moisture from the river increases heave risk. A 36-inch depth is a standard engineering practice for stability.
